 Notes & Reviews Back to Top 
When Del Monaco appeared with the Bolshoi in 1959, he became the first Italian opera singer to perform in Soviet Russia. Carmen scenes with Del Monaco, Arkhipova, and Lisitsian; Melik-Pashaev, cond. Pagliacci scenes with Del Monaco and Maslennicova; Tieskovini, cond. Black & White, 90 minutes, optional subtitles in English, French, German, Italian, and Spanish, All regions.
